A scarecrow trail through a picturesque Berkshire village went down a treat at the weekend.

The quirky Sonning Scarecrow Trail wowed villagers and visitors on Sunday, May 26 and Monday, May 27.

From Barbie scarecrows to Minions, Lego and more, the trail-goers were given the option to buy a route map for £5 - with money going toward village amenities.

The event sees Sonning villagers come together to create an array of models, which are then presented on front lawns and even at the odd bus stop.

The event is held every two years and this year saw more than 50 scarecrows peppered around the village for families to hunt out along the trail.

Other elements of the event included a vintage car display and open gardens.

The winner of the competition has not yet been announced.
